You must determine the importance of services and the resources in a service. Rely on sources of information such as business continuity plans, disaster recovery plans, and service-level agreements to obtain the services that are most important to your enterprise.
Typically, more information is available about business-critical services, making them the ideal place to start service modeling. Not all services require the same level of complexity. A critical business service may be documented in enough detail for you to create a comprehensive service model, while for a less critical service, a simpler model will suffice. CA SOI provides the flexibility for models of different detail levels, and you can make models more comprehensive as your investment level in the product grows.
Also determine the importance of the resources that make up a service, so that this importance is accurately reflected when issues occur.
